Running six nights a week, the Night Riviera service takes you from London Paddington station to several stations in Cornwall, including Bodmin Parkway, St Austell, Truro, Penzance and more. Did you know, there are four scenic railway lines connect the county from north to south: The St Ives Bay Line, The Looe Valley Line, The Maritime Line and The Atlantic Coast Line and you can book tickets for all of them right here. Reaching the coast via the Luxulyan Valley and travelling through the Goss Moor, this train route gives you beautiful views of the coast before arriving in the family-friendly resort of Newquay, a perfect classic seaside holiday that also offers excellent surfing. In fact, a single flight from London to Cornwall emits six times more CO than taking the same journey by train. The RMT union has called its members out on strike on Friday 2 June.
